Navigation strategies typically use linearized techniques to predict maneuver statistics. This method has been successfully employed on numerous high-energy trajectories, but may not be valid for low-energy ones due to the highly non-linear environment. We explore nonlinear navigational techniques applied to a Europa Lander concept by assessing trajectory sensitivity. The linearity assumption is tested at different phases of the endgame trajectory. Maneuver strategies and placement are considered to improve the delivery to Europa. Several cases of non-linear statistical maneuver Monte Carlo simulations are conducted to optimize maneuvers and compare ∆V statistics against conventional linear simulations.
